def grade_page_visit(visit, visit_grade_model=FlowPageVisitGrade,
        grade_data=None, graded_at_git_commit_sha=None):
    if not visit.is_graded_answer:
        raise RuntimeError("cannot grade ungraded answer")

    flow_session = visit.flow_session
    course = flow_session.course
    page_data = visit.page_data

    from course.content import (
            get_course_repo,
            get_course_commit_sha,
            get_flow_commit_sha,
            get_flow_desc,
            get_flow_page_desc,
            instantiate_flow_page)

    repo = get_course_repo(course)

    course_commit_sha = get_course_commit_sha(
            course, flow_session.participation)

    flow_desc_pre = get_flow_desc(repo, course,
            flow_session.flow_id, course_commit_sha)

    flow_commit_sha = get_flow_commit_sha(
            course, flow_session.participation, flow_desc_pre,
            visit.flow_session)

    flow_desc = get_flow_desc(repo, course,
            flow_session.flow_id, flow_commit_sha)

    page_desc = get_flow_page_desc(
            flow_session.flow_id,
            flow_desc,
            page_data.group_id, page_data.page_id)

    page = instantiate_flow_page(
            location="flow '%s', group, '%s', page '%s'"
            % (flow_session.flow_id, page_data.group_id, page_data.page_id),
            repo=repo, page_desc=page_desc,
            commit_sha=flow_commit_sha)

    from course.page import PageContext
    grading_page_context = PageContext(
            course=course,
            repo=repo,
            commit_sha=flow_commit_sha)

    answer_feedback = page.grade(
            grading_page_context, visit.page_data.data,
            visit.answer, grade_data=grade_data)

    grade = visit_grade_model()
    grade.visit = visit
    grade.grade_data = grade_data
    grade.max_points = page.max_points(visit.page_data)
    grade.graded_at_git_commit_sha = graded_at_git_commit_sha

    if answer_feedback is not None:
        grade.correctness = answer_feedback.correctness
        grade.feedback = answer_feedback.as_json()

    grade.save()

def page_analytics(pctx, flow_identifier, group_id, page_id):
    if pctx.role not in [
            participation_role.teaching_assistant,
            participation_role.instructor,
            participation_role.observer,
            ]:
        raise PermissionDenied("must be at least TA to view analytics")

    flow_desc = get_flow_desc(pctx.repo, pctx.course, flow_identifier,
            pctx.course_commit_sha)

    is_multiple_submit = is_flow_multiple_submit(flow_desc)

    page_cache = PageInstanceCache(pctx.repo, pctx.course, flow_identifier)

    visits = (FlowPageVisit.objects
            .filter(
                flow_session__flow_id=flow_identifier,
                page_data__group_id=group_id,
                page_data__page_id=page_id,
                is_graded_answer=True,
                ))

    if is_multiple_submit and connection.features.can_distinct_on_fields:
        visits = (visits
                .distinct("page_data", "visit_time")
                .order_by("page_data", "-visit_time"))

    visits = (visits
            .prefetch_related("flow_session")
            .prefetch_related("page_data"))

    normalized_answer_and_correctness_to_count = {}

    title = None
    body = None
    total_count = 0

    for visit in visits:
        flow_commit_sha = get_flow_commit_sha(
                pctx.course, pctx.participation, flow_desc,
                visit.flow_session)
        page = page_cache.get_page(group_id, page_id, flow_commit_sha)

        from course.page import PageContext
        grading_page_context = PageContext(
                course=pctx.course,
                repo=pctx.repo,
                commit_sha=flow_commit_sha)

        title = page.title(grading_page_context, visit.page_data.data)
        body = page.body(grading_page_context, visit.page_data.data)

        answer_feedback = visit.get_most_recent_feedback()

        if answer_feedback is not None:
            key = (answer_feedback.normalized_answer,
                    answer_feedback.correctness)
            normalized_answer_and_correctness_to_count[key] = \
                    normalized_answer_and_correctness_to_count.get(key, 0) + 1

            total_count += 1

    answer_stats = []
    for (normalized_answer, correctness), count in \
            normalized_answer_and_correctness_to_count.iteritems():
        answer_stats.append(
                AnswerStats(
                    normalized_answer=normalized_answer,
                    correctness=correctness,
                    count=count,
                    percentage=safe_div(100 * count, total_count)))

    answer_stats = sorted(
            answer_stats,
            key=lambda astats: astats.percentage,
            reverse=True)

    return render_course_page(pctx, "course/analytics-page.html", {
        "flow_identifier": flow_identifier,
        "group_id": group_id,
        "page_id": page_id,
        "title": title,
        "body": body,
        "answer_stats_list": answer_stats,
        })

def make_page_answer_stats_list(pctx, flow_identifier):
    flow_desc = get_flow_desc(pctx.repo, pctx.course, flow_identifier,
            pctx.course_commit_sha)

    is_multiple_submit = is_flow_multiple_submit(flow_desc)

    page_cache = PageInstanceCache(pctx.repo, pctx.course, flow_identifier)

    page_info_list = []
    for group_desc in flow_desc.groups:
        for page_desc in group_desc.pages:
            points = 0
            count = 0

            visits = (FlowPageVisit.objects
                    .filter(
                        flow_session__flow_id=flow_identifier,
                        page_data__group_id=group_desc.id,
                        page_data__page_id=page_desc.id,
                        is_graded_answer=True,
                        ))

            if is_multiple_submit and connection.features.can_distinct_on_fields:
                visits = (visits
                        .distinct("page_data")
                        .order_by("page_data", "-visit_time"))

            visits = (visits
                    .prefetch_related("flow_session")
                    .prefetch_related("page_data"))

            title = None
            for visit in visits:
                flow_commit_sha = get_flow_commit_sha(
                        pctx.course, pctx.participation, flow_desc,
                        visit.flow_session)
                page = page_cache.get_page(group_desc.id, page_desc.id,
                        flow_commit_sha)

                from course.page import PageContext
                grading_page_context = PageContext(
                        course=pctx.course,
                        repo=pctx.repo,
                        commit_sha=flow_commit_sha)

                title = page.title(grading_page_context, visit.page_data.data)

                answer_feedback = visit.get_most_recent_feedback()

                if (answer_feedback is not None
                        and answer_feedback.correctness is not None):
                    count += 1
                    points += answer_feedback.correctness

            page_info_list.append(
                    PageAnswerStats(
                        group_id=group_desc.id,
                        page_id=page_desc.id,
                        title=title,
                        average_correctness=safe_div(points, count),
                        answer_count=count,
                        url=reverse(
                            "course.analytics.page_analytics",
                            args=(
                                pctx.course_identifier,
                                flow_identifier,
                                group_desc.id,
                                page_desc.id,
                                ))))

    return page_info_list
